I am :D....dan ternyata, Ngoc Son Temple itu artinya Temple of the Jade mountain...hmmm, once I found out the meaning of this, I immediately tried to find where the jade and the mountain were...Apparently, this temple was built on the islet of the Hoan Kiem Lake, making it one of the most popular as well as picturesque spots in Viet Nam's capital city..

Built as a small temple, Ngoc Son Pagoda was renovated and expanded by Nguyen Van Sieu, a famous scholars, in 1864

From the open sources I got, this Pagoda is also dedicated to Tran Hung Dao,  Prince of Thang Long of the Tran Dynasty who happened to be the Supreme Commander of Viet Nam at that time...

Heading to the Pagoda, we have to cross this beautfull and bright red bridge of Welcoming Morning Sunshine..or in Vietnamese called Cầu Thê Húc...what a brilliant name! I love it ..and it suits it fine, as I had a bright sunny day as I crossed this bridge and visited the temple....

Once you crossed the bridge, you will find the gate, which, according to my brochure, includes the Pen Tower  or in Vietnamese called Thap But...in my photo below, the pen part is not really that clear as it was covered by green lush trees....

As a matter of fact, the Temple is full of symbolic buildings and relics....They also have the ink-slab or ink stand (Dai Nghien), the Moon Contemplation Pavilion (Dac Nguyet) and the Pavilion against Waves (Đình Trấn Ba)...Too bad I didn't have enough time to ask more of the meaning of these parts...I suspected they were closely related to the religious elements as well as ancient wisdom dearly held by the Vietnamese people...
